    Product Description

    JC2-11 is an inflammasome inhibitor.1 It inhibits increases in IL-1β production induced by the NOD-like receptor protein 3 (NLRP3) activators ATP (Item Nos. 14498 | 40182), nigericin (Item No. 11437), or monosodium urate crystals in LPS-primed primary mouse bone marrow-derived macrophages (BMDMs) when used at concentrations of 50 or 100 µM. JC2-11 (100 µM) inhibits increases in IL-1β production induced by flagellin or dsDNA, which are activators of NLR family CARD domain-containing protein 4 (NLRC4) and absent in melanoma 2 (AIM2), respectively, in LPS-primed primary mouse BMDMs. It also scavenges DPPH (Item No. 14805) radicals in a cell-free assay (IC50 = 52.5 µM) and inhibits LPS-induced nitric oxide (NO) production in primary rat microglial cells.2 JC2-11 (10 mg/kg) inhibits LPS-induced increases in IL-1β production in peritoneal lavage fluid in mice.1
